While Chuck is King of the K of H, a great deal of the responsibility of the parade traditionally falls to the krewe captain. In New Orleans the captain is strictly masked, often on horseback, and is the principal krewe authority figure. In Cajun country the capitaine is the leader of the carnival gang.
